I'm at the point where I don't need to keep such a close eye on my reports. I noticed there are 2 options for stopping the payment from being deducted, pause and cancel. Cancel is self-explanatory, but not sure about the pause. Does pause allow you to still see changes in your Fico 8 scores and just not get the 28 scores 3b update on schedule?
Pausing your myFICO subscription allows you to retain past information (reports, scores, etc). Cancelling your myFICO subscription will delete your account completely, and all documented history under the account will cease to exist.

So basically... If you no longer need to get updates on your subscription, but don't want to lose any history, it would be best to pause your subscription just before it renews. If you no longer need to have access to the history either, then cancel your subscription at any time. Keep in mind that if you cancel, you can re-subscribe at any time, but you won't have the previous information from your account.
